There are a number of things you can expect from this survey and some of them include:

Written and verbal report on the condition of the roof
There are multiple things that are covered under this such as:
• Roof covering basics including age, how long it is expected to last, suspected leaks and any conditions that can be compared to similar properties.
• Rainwater and gutter systems- type, blockages/blocking, cracks/damage, leaking.
• Ridge tiles- the condition of tiles & mortar as well as an iron check.
• Chimney stacks- the condition of mortar and brickwork, worn flaunching, lose chimney pots, and flashing kinds.
• Gulley’s and valleys- fatigue splits and any repairs required.
• Skylights and roof window- flashing check, as well as inspection of fogging units or cracked glass.
• Flat roofs-condition of the flat roof, inspection for soft spots and roof covering.
• The structure of the roof- this includes a thorough internal and external check for roof spread, roof sag, Purlin condition & support, ventilation, condensation issues, tie bars, and wall plates.
• Dormer roofs- covering and durability.

Quote to fix any problems
If there are any problems identified during the survey, the roofer is supposed to present a written quote. This should be well detailed so that you can know exactly what the problem is and the solutions they apply. It helps to get at least three quotes from different companies to choose the one you feel will work out best for you. Approach this with a lot of caution to make sure you are not exploited in any way but end up getting great value for the money you will be investing in.

Images of damage
To know that you will not be taken for a ride by the roofing contractors, demand evidence of the damage. Viewing pictures of the damage assures you that it exists, and you can also gauge the extent of damage to know that the roofer has not invented the problem.

Action plan
A roof survey is not complete without an action plan. The contractor should offer written and verbal plan of action that ensures your roof functions the way it is supposed to for an extended period. This is crucial as it will also help you prepare beforehand so as to avoid nasty surprises. If the roof is in tip-top condition and does not need any work, the contractor should be honest about this and give you expert advice on how best to take great care of the roof.
